About HMC
Harvard Model Congress (HMC) stands as the world’s largest congressional simulation conference, offering high school students an immersive and dynamic experience. With participation open to students from the United States and abroad, HMC presents a unique opportunity to engage in a realistic model congress simulation. The entire event is organized and run by our devoted team of Harvard undergraduates, ensuring a high-quality and impactful experience for all participants.
About the program
Welcome to HMC Young Leadership Program, it's an intensive 4-day program led by HMC mentors focusing on leadership activities, a contextual problem and how to solve it through a group effort. Going through a packed curriculum, students will learn how to come up with innovative solutions to some of the most pressing issues of our times. The mentors will teach you how to think through problems critically and creatively and will help you in creating an actionable plan.
